Output a51b752d84aaac293fa414082565835e0fc07a94823028683e6e73c03be5d3d8:41

value
58765
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ebb03f1588e0ab553200803232fbe7d3944f3d48 OP_EQUAL
address
3PBDrSUSy2tDwx4vRqj6CcJTgiUTnh9zFP
transaction
a51b752d84aaac293fa414082565835e0fc07a94823028683e6e73c03be5d3d8
spent
true